7:2 KJV
Parallel Verses
  • King James Version - That the princes of Israel, heads of the house of their fathers, who were the princes of the tribes, and were over them that were numbered, offered:
  • 新标点和合本 - 当天,以色列的众首领,就是各族的族长,都来奉献。他们是各支派的首领,管理那些被数的人。
  • 和合本2010(上帝版-简体) - 以色列的领袖,各父家的家长,都前来奉献。他们是各支派的领袖,管理那些被数的人。
  • 和合本2010(神版-简体) - 以色列的领袖,各父家的家长,都前来奉献。他们是各支派的领袖,管理那些被数的人。
  • 当代译本 - 然后,以色列各支派的首领,就是负责统计人口的各族长,都来奉献。
  • 圣经新译本 - 以色列的众领袖,就是他们父家的首领,都来奉献;就是众支派的领袖,是管理那些被数点的人的。
  • 中文标准译本 - 以色列的众领袖,他们各父家的首领就来奉献。他们是那些协助数点人口的各支派领袖。
  • 现代标点和合本 - 当天,以色列的众首领,就是各族的族长,都来奉献。他们是各支派的首领,管理那些被数的人。
  • 和合本(拼音版) - 当天,以色列的众首领,就是各族的族长,都来奉献。他们是各支派的首领,管理那些被数的人。
  • New International Version - Then the leaders of Israel, the heads of families who were the tribal leaders in charge of those who were counted, made offerings.
  • New International Reader's Version - Then the leaders of Israel brought their offerings. The leaders were the heads of the families. They were the leaders of the tribes. They were in charge of the men who had been counted.
  • English Standard Version - the chiefs of Israel, heads of their fathers’ houses, who were the chiefs of the tribes, who were over those who were listed, approached
  • New Living Translation - Then the leaders of Israel—the tribal leaders who had registered the troops—came and brought their offerings.
  • The Message - The leaders of Israel, the heads of the ancestral tribes who had carried out the census, brought offerings. They presented before God six covered wagons and twelve oxen, a wagon from each pair of leaders and an ox from each leader.
  • Christian Standard Bible - the leaders of Israel, the heads of their ancestral families, presented an offering. They were the tribal leaders who supervised the registration.
  • New American Standard Bible - Then the leaders of Israel, the heads of their fathers’ households, made an offering (they were the leaders of the tribes; they were the supervisors over the numbered men).
  • New King James Version - Then the leaders of Israel, the heads of their fathers’ houses, who were the leaders of the tribes and over those who were numbered, made an offering.
  • Amplified Bible - Then the leaders of Israel, the heads of their fathers’ households, made offerings. (These were the leaders of the tribes; they were the ones who were over the men who were numbered.)
  • American Standard Version - that the princes of Israel, the heads of their fathers’ houses, offered. These were the princes of the tribes, these are they that were over them that were numbered:
  • New English Translation - Then the leaders of Israel, the heads of their clans, made an offering. They were the leaders of the tribes; they were the ones who had been supervising the numbering.
  • World English Bible - the princes of Israel, the heads of their fathers’ houses, offered. These were the princes of the tribes. These are they who were over those who were counted;

Cross Reference
  • 1 Chronicles 29:6 - Then the chief of the fathers and princes of the tribes of Israel, and the captains of thousands and of hundreds, with the rulers of the king's work, offered willingly,
  • 1 Chronicles 29:7 - And gave for the service of the house of God of gold five thousand talents and ten thousand drams, and of silver ten thousand talents, and of brass eighteen thousand talents, and one hundred thousand talents of iron.
  • 1 Chronicles 29:8 - And they with whom precious stones were found gave them to the treasure of the house of the Lord, by the hand of Jehiel the Gershonite.
  • Numbers 2:1 - And the Lord spake unto Moses and unto Aaron, saying,
  • Numbers 2:2 - Every man of the children of Israel shall pitch by his own standard, with the ensign of their father's house: far off about the tabernacle of the congregation shall they pitch.
  • Numbers 2:3 - And on the east side toward the rising of the sun shall they of the standard of the camp of Judah pitch throughout their armies: and Nahshon the son of Amminadab shall be captain of the children of Judah.
  • Numbers 2:4 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were threescore and fourteen thousand and six hundred.
  • Numbers 2:5 - And those that do pitch next unto him shall be the tribe of Issachar: and Nethaneel the son of Zuar shall be captain of the children of Issachar.
  • Numbers 2:6 - And his host, and those that were numbered thereof, were fifty and four thousand and four hundred.
  • Numbers 2:7 - Then the tribe of Zebulun: and Eliab the son of Helon shall be captain of the children of Zebulun.
  • Numbers 2:8 - And his host, and those that were numbered thereof, were fifty and seven thousand and four hundred.
  • Numbers 2:9 - All that were numbered in the camp of Judah were an hundred thousand and fourscore thousand and six thousand and four hundred, throughout their armies. These shall first set forth.
  • Numbers 2:10 - On the south side shall be the standard of the camp of Reuben according to their armies: and the captain of the children of Reuben shall be Elizur the son of Shedeur.
  • Numbers 2:11 - And his host, and those that were numbered thereof, were forty and six thousand and five hundred.
  • Numbers 2:12 - And those which pitch by him shall be the tribe of Simeon: and the captain of the children of Simeon shall be Shelumiel the son of Zurishaddai.
  • Numbers 2:13 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were fifty and nine thousand and three hundred.
  • Numbers 2:14 - Then the tribe of Gad: and the captain of the sons of Gad shall be Eliasaph the son of Reuel.
  • Numbers 2:15 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were forty and five thousand and six hundred and fifty.
  • Numbers 2:16 - All that were numbered in the camp of Reuben were an hundred thousand and fifty and one thousand and four hundred and fifty, throughout their armies. And they shall set forth in the second rank.
  • Numbers 2:17 - Then the tabernacle of the congregation shall set forward with the camp of the Levites in the midst of the camp: as they encamp, so shall they set forward, every man in his place by their standards.
  • Numbers 2:18 - On the west side shall be the standard of the camp of Ephraim according to their armies: and the captain of the sons of Ephraim shall be Elishama the son of Ammihud.
  • Numbers 2:19 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were forty thousand and five hundred.
  • Numbers 2:20 - And by him shall be the tribe of Manasseh: and the captain of the children of Manasseh shall be Gamaliel the son of Pedahzur.
  • Numbers 2:21 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were thirty and two thousand and two hundred.
  • Numbers 2:22 - Then the tribe of Benjamin: and the captain of the sons of Benjamin shall be Abidan the son of Gideoni.
  • Numbers 2:23 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were thirty and five thousand and four hundred.
  • Numbers 2:24 - All that were numbered of the camp of Ephraim were an hundred thousand and eight thousand and an hundred, throughout their armies. And they shall go forward in the third rank.
  • Numbers 2:25 - The standard of the camp of Dan shall be on the north side by their armies: and the captain of the children of Dan shall be Ahiezer the son of Ammishaddai.
  • Numbers 2:26 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were threescore and two thousand and seven hundred.
  • Numbers 2:27 - And those that encamp by him shall be the tribe of Asher: and the captain of the children of Asher shall be Pagiel the son of Ocran.
  • Numbers 2:28 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were forty and one thousand and five hundred.
  • Numbers 2:29 - Then the tribe of Naphtali: and the captain of the children of Naphtali shall be Ahira the son of Enan.
  • Numbers 2:30 - And his host, and those that were numbered of them, were fifty and three thousand and four hundred.
  • Numbers 2:31 - All they that were numbered in the camp of Dan were an hundred thousand and fifty and seven thousand and six hundred. They shall go hindmost with their standards.
  • Numbers 2:32 - These are those which were numbered of the children of Israel by the house of their fathers: all those that were numbered of the camps throughout their hosts were six hundred thousand and three thousand and five hundred and fifty.
  • Numbers 2:33 - But the Levites were not numbered among the children of Israel; as the Lord commanded Moses.
  • Numbers 2:34 - And the children of Israel did according to all that the Lord commanded Moses: so they pitched by their standards, and so they set forward, every one after their families, according to the house of their fathers.

  • Numbers 10:1 - And the Lord spake unto Moses, saying,
  • Numbers 10:2 - Make thee two trumpets of silver; of a whole piece shalt thou make them: that thou mayest use them for the calling of the assembly, and for the journeying of the camps.
  • Numbers 10:3 - And when they shall blow with them, all the assembly shall assemble themselves to thee at the door of the tabernacle of the congregation.
  • Numbers 10:4 - And if they blow but with one trumpet, then the princes, which are heads of the thousands of Israel, shall gather themselves unto thee.
  • Numbers 10:5 - When ye blow an alarm, then the camps that lie on the east parts shall go forward.
  • Numbers 10:6 - When ye blow an alarm the second time, then the camps that lie on the south side shall take their journey: they shall blow an alarm for their journeys.
  • Numbers 10:7 - But when the congregation is to be gathered together, ye shall blow, but ye shall not sound an alarm.
  • Numbers 10:8 - And the sons of Aaron, the priests, shall blow with the trumpets; and they shall be to you for an ordinance for ever throughout your generations.
  • Numbers 10:9 - And if ye go to war in your land against the enemy that oppresseth you, then ye shall blow an alarm with the trumpets; and ye shall be remembered before the Lord your God, and ye shall be saved from your enemies.
  • Numbers 10:10 - Also in the day of your gladness, and in your solemn days, and in the beginnings of your months, ye shall blow with the trumpets over your burnt offerings, and over the sacrifices of your peace offerings; that they may be to you for a memorial before your God: I am the Lord your God.
  • Numbers 10:11 - And it came to pass on the twentieth day of the second month, in the second year, that the cloud was taken up from off the tabernacle of the testimony.
  • Numbers 10:12 - And the children of Israel took their journeys out of the wilderness of Sinai; and the cloud rested in the wilderness of Paran.
  • Numbers 10:13 - And they first took their journey according to the commandment of the Lord by the hand of Moses.
  • Numbers 10:14 - In the first place went the standard of the camp of the children of Judah according to their armies: and over his host was Nahshon the son of Amminadab.
  • Numbers 10:15 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Issachar was Nethaneel the son of Zuar.
  • Numbers 10:16 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Zebulun was Eliab the son of Helon.
  • Numbers 10:17 - And the tabernacle was taken down; and the sons of Gershon and the sons of Merari set forward, bearing the tabernacle.
  • Numbers 10:18 - And the standard of the camp of Reuben set forward according to their armies: and over his host was Elizur the son of Shedeur.
  • Numbers 10:19 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Simeon was Shelumiel the son of Zurishaddai.
  • Numbers 10:20 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Gad was Eliasaph the son of Deuel.
  • Numbers 10:21 - And the Kohathites set forward, bearing the sanctuary: and the other did set up the tabernacle against they came.
  • Numbers 10:22 - And the standard of the camp of the children of Ephraim set forward according to their armies: and over his host was Elishama the son of Ammihud.
  • Numbers 10:23 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Manasseh was Gamaliel the son of Pedahzur.
  • Numbers 10:24 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Benjamin was Abidan the son of Gideoni.
  • Numbers 10:25 - And the standard of the camp of the children of Dan set forward, which was the rearward of all the camps throughout their hosts: and over his host was Ahiezer the son of Ammishaddai.
  • Numbers 10:26 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Asher was Pagiel the son of Ocran.
  • Numbers 10:27 - And over the host of the tribe of the children of Naphtali was Ahira the son of Enan.
  • Numbers 10:28 - Thus were the journeyings of the children of Israel according to their armies, when they set forward.
  • Numbers 10:29 - And Moses said unto Hobab, the son of Reuel the Midianite, Moses' father in law, We are journeying unto the place of which the Lord said, I will give it you: come thou with us, and we will do thee good: for the Lord hath spoken good concerning Israel.
  • Numbers 10:30 - And he said unto him, I will not go; but I will depart to mine own land, and to my kindred.
  • Numbers 10:31 - And he said, Leave us not, I pray thee; forasmuch as thou knowest how we are to encamp in the wilderness, and thou mayest be to us instead of eyes.
  • Numbers 10:32 - And it shall be, if thou go with us, yea, it shall be, that what goodness the Lord shall do unto us, the same will we do unto thee.
  • Numbers 10:33 - And they departed from the mount of the Lord three days' journey: and the ark of the covenant of the Lord went before them in the three days' journey, to search out a resting place for them.
  • Numbers 10:34 - And the cloud of the Lord was upon them by day, when they went out of the camp.
  • Numbers 10:35 - And it came to pass, when the ark set forward, that Moses said, Rise up, Lord, and let thine enemies be scattered; and let them that hate thee flee before thee.
  • Numbers 10:36 - And when it rested, he said, Return, O Lord, unto the many thousands of Israel.
